TOMAS, Catarina  and  GONCALVES, Carolina. PROFILES OF TRAINEES IN SUPERVISED TEACHING PRACTICE IN PORTUGAL. Cad. Pesqui. [online]. 2019, vol.49, n.174, pp.168-181.  Epub Nov 20, 2019. ISSN 1980-5314.  https://doi.org/10.1590/198053146432.

This article presents three exploratory profiles of reflexive practices from a sample of 115 student-trainees who attend teacher training masters programs in early childhood education and in teaching 1st and 2nd cycle of basic education, in mainland Portugal, regarding prática de ensino supervisionada (PES) [supervised teaching practice]. The data presented comes from the statistical analysis based on análise de correspondências múltiplas (ACM) [multiple correspondence analysis]. It allows to identify two profiles set apart by the impact of the reflections written during STP and their respective justification based on the subsystem of higher education they attend, the legal nature of the subsystem and the adopted models. The data also differentiated a third group based on the pedagogical model adopted and the subsystem.
